Bandırma sits at the edge of the Sea of Marmara, a port city that has long served as a threshold between land and water, movement and settlement. LOG-IN PARK, led by architect Nilüfer Kozikoğlu in collaboration with planning and landscape design groups from Istanbul Technical University, takes this condition of transit seriously. Developed for the port area and awarded second place in the 2017 International Bandırma Design Park competition, the project transforms a logistically significant but underutilized site into a layered public destination: a design institute, a Skywalk, a five-star hotel and convention center, retail and dining, an event platform, a city gate, and a land library, bound together by a coherent spatial and ecological vision.

The design method is what the team calls a "dynamic canvas," a process of relational mapping that charts connections between concrete and abstract elements, past conditions and future possibilities, physical space and digital experience. The architecture moves from diagram to three-dimensional form through algorithmic and parametric modeling, resulting in complex plan configurations that respond to the shifting nature of public, shared, and private space within a park setting. At the center of this system stands the LOG-IN PARK Design Institute, rendered in precise fair-faced concrete geometries, a building that embodies the project's commitment to knowledge, education, and rigorous design thinking. A companion mobile application extends this logic into the experiential realm, creating new spatial correspondences between the built environment and its users.

Beneath the formal ambition runs a consistent ecological and cultural sensibility. The project incorporates indigenous local knowledge, a seed lab, gastronomic programming, and archaeological awareness as architectural strategies rather than afterthoughts, weaving the historical heritage of Bandırma, its places, its people, and its buildings, into the fabric of the design. The result is a project that holds its many scales together: urban and intimate, data-driven and deeply contextual, forward-looking and grounded in the specific character of a city that has always existed at the meeting point of things.
